| System-wide General Education Requirements* | 30 |
| Institutional Graduation Requirements |
5 |
| Information Technology Literacy Requirement** |
8 |
| *
Majors must take ECON 201 and MATH 102 as part of the system-wide
general education requirements. Computer Information Systems majors who
test directly into MATH 121 do not need to complete MATH 102. |
|
| **
Majors must take CIS 130 as part of the information technology literacy
requirements. The MATH 112 ITL requirement is met when the student
completes MATH 121. |
